lawyers professional liability coverage

Provides attorneys with liability coverage for financial loss suffered by third parties arising from acts, errors, and omissions in providing professional, legal services. Fraud, intentional and criminal acts, bodily injury, and property damage are excluded from coverage. However, most of the policies provide coverage for personal injury perils (i.e., defamation, invasion of privacy) since allegations of such acts occur frequently in the legal arena. As is the case with most professional liability forms, lawyers professional liability policies are written with a claims-made coverage trigger. In addition to commercial insurers, lawyers professional liability coverage is also available in many states through bar-sponsored captive insurers.
